Signs Your Heating System Needs Professional Cleaning
Musty or Stale Odors from Vents
A persistent, musty odor coming from your vents usually indicates a buildup of dust, dirt, or mold within your ductwork or on your heating coils. In damp climates, airborne contaminants easily settle and multiply inside dark ventilation systems. Ignoring these smells allows poor indoor air quality to trigger allergies and respiratory issues throughout your property.
Reduced Airflow or Uneven Heating
If you turn up the thermostat but certain rooms remain noticeably colder, you are likely dealing with restricted airflow. This is a classic sign of heavily clogged air filters, dirty blower components, or significant debris buildup within the heating ducts. Your system has to work much harder to compensate, leading to increased wear and tear on critical components.
Noticeable Increase in Energy Bills
When your monthly heating costs steadily rise without a change in utility rates, a dirty heating system is often the culprit. Components caked with grime force the equipment to expend significantly more energy to produce and distribute heat. Over time, this sustained inefficiency causes irreparable damage to the system and drains your budget.
Visible Dust or Debris Around Vents
Seeing dust or lint accumulating around your heating registers shortly after cleaning means your internal components are heavily soiled. The airflow is literally pushing visible contaminants out into your living or working space. This directly compromises your indoor air quality and suggests a deeper cleanliness issue that requires professional intervention.
Unusual Noises During Operation
A heating system that rattles, hums loudly, or grinds when it starts up is often struggling against internal friction caused by dirt buildup. Blower motors coated in thick dust become unbalanced, causing vibrations that echo through your ductwork. Addressing this quickly prevents the motor from burning out entirely due to the excessive strain.
What's Actually Making Your Heating System Underperform?
Accumulated Dust and Environmental Debris
Over time, heating systems naturally pull in dust, pet dander, and airborne particles from your indoor environment. A mature tree canopy and proximity to water mean higher pollen counts and significant leaf fall that easily get drawn into older heating systems. The solution involves a comprehensive cleaning of all internal components, including blowers, coils, and heat exchangers.
Clogged Air Filters
Air filters are designed to capture airborne contaminants before they enter your heating system, but they become saturated with dirt when not changed regularly. A damp environment can cause these filters to degrade faster or trap moisture, severely restricting airflow. Fixing this requires replacing the filters and inspecting the system to ensure no bypass airflow is occurring around the housing.
Mold or Mildew Growth in Ductwork
Excess moisture combined with organic matter creates an ideal breeding ground for mold and mildew within your heating and ventilation system. The consistently damp climate of the area, combined with older ductwork in established Montlake properties, significantly increases this risk. We tackle this with specialized duct cleaning, anti-microbial treatments, and identifying underlying moisture issues.
Soiled Heat Exchangers and Burners
In gas furnaces, the burners and heat exchanger are responsible for safely generating and transferring heat. When these components get coated in soot or dust, the combustion process becomes highly inefficient and potentially unsafe. Professional cleaning removes this buildup, ensuring the fuel burns cleanly and the heat transfers properly into your air supply.

The Impact on Equipment Lifespan
Every heating system has an expected lifespan, but running a unit while it is packed with dirt will cut those years short. The blower motor has to work overtime to push air through clogged coils and dirty filters, which eventually causes the motor to overheat and fail. Investing in professional cleaning now protects the thousands of dollars you have already invested in your heating equipment.
Safety Risks of Neglected Systems
For gas-powered heating systems, a lack of cleaning can actually become a safety hazard. Dirt and soot buildup on burners can cause delayed ignition or uneven flames, while a fouled heat exchanger can crack and leak carbon monoxide into your living space. Regular professional cleaning ensures these combustion components remain spotless and safe to operate year-round.
